Answer is C) 100.56 m2β which is close to 100 m2. Option is given in mm2 which is wrong it should be given in m2
The total surface area of a sphere is β4πr2. Radius of each alveoli is 0.1mm.
Therefore surface area of a single alveoli is = β4πr2 = 4x 22/7x 0.1 x 0.1 = 0.1257 mm2.
Converting the value into m2 gives 0.1257/106 m2
Now there are 400 million alveoli in each lung, so the surface area of one lung = 0.1257/106 x 400 x 106 = 50.28 m2
There are two lungs in each person, therefore the total respiratory surface of the person will be = 2 x 50.28 = 100.56 m2
Options are given in mm2 which is wrong it should be given inβ m2.
